Bong Joon Ho Expresses Regret and Self-Blame About Lee Sun Gyun

Director Bong Joon Ho expresses deep remorse over the untimely passing of actor Lee Sun Gyun.

In a recent appearance on MBC's 'Sohn's Questions' show on February 18, Director Bong opened up about his feelings of regret and self-reproach in the wake of Lee Sun Gyun's tragic death. The duo had collaborated on the critically acclaimed 'Parasite', which won top honors at the Academy Awards.

During the show, host Sohn Suk Hee touched upon the lingering sorrow felt by many over Lee's passing and sought Bong's perspective on the heartbreaking loss.

Bong shared his heartfelt reflections, stating, "He was not just a colleague but someone I shared countless memories with. Regardless of what is said, he was truly a kind-hearted individual and an exceptional actor."

The director also revisited the statement he released following Lee's death, expressing his inner turmoil over the timing of his response. He lamented not speaking out sooner and expressed profound regret and shame over his delayed reaction to the situation.

Lee Sun Gyun had faced drug-related accusations leading to a police investigation in October 2023. Despite vehemently declaring his innocence during three rounds of questioning, his life came to a tragic end on December 27, 2023.

The news of Lee's passing sent shockwaves through the entertainment industry, prompting tributes and mourning from colleagues and fans alike. Bong Joon Ho had openly criticized the handling of the police investigation and raised concerns about the transparency and thoroughness of the process.
